How to Choose the Right Utility Locating Equipment

Choosing a utility locator comes down to balancing your requirements – from the kind of utilities you're detecting to the job environments and your budget. Whether you're comparing a high-end option or an entry-level model, keep these key factors in mind:

Utility Type (Electric, Gas, Telecom, Water)

Different utilities present different locating challenges.

Electric lines: Look for locators with passive power modes and fault-finding capability to detect live cables and pinpoint shorts or breaks. Advanced models (like Radiodetection) even include voltmeters and simultaneous fault locate features for electric utilities.

Gas and water pipelines: Many are plastic or non-metallic, meaning a standard electromagnetic locator won't see them without a tracer wire. In these cases, you may need alternative locating methods like ground penetrating radar (GPR) to spot plastic or concrete pipes, or use a sonde (a small transmitter) fed into the line.

Telecom and fiber-optic conduits: Often run in bundled cables or non-metal ducts, so a multi-frequency locator helps isolate specific lines. You'll want the ability to use higher frequencies for short, insulated runs and lower frequencies for long cable routes, ensuring you can accurately trace telecom lines without bleeding signal into neighboring utilities.

Frequency Range & Signal Strength

Frequency flexibility is one of the most important features of a professional locator. Multi-frequency models (like those from Radiodetection or Schonstedt) give you more control in different soil conditions and congestion levels, improving accuracy in busy underground areas.

High frequencies (33 kHz and above) are great for inducing signals on shallow or insulated lines, while low frequencies (like 512 Hz or 8 kHz) travel farther on conductive pipes and cables – crucial for long-distance locates.

Additionally, check the transmitter's power output. Higher wattage transmitters and multiple power level settings let you push a strong signal on long or deep lines. This matters when you need to trace a utility a quarter-mile down a rural road or through tough, clay soil.

In short: choose a locator that covers a broad frequency range and ample signal power so you're prepared for both delicate, high-detail jobs and brute-force deep locates.

Urban vs. Rural Environments

Work environment should influence your equipment choice.

In urban areas, you'll encounter a maze of closely packed utilities and plenty of electrical noise. Look for locators with advanced filtering or noise rejection – for example, Radiodetection's units include Dynamic Overload Protection to automatically filter out interference from high-voltage lines or substations. This feature prevents the receiver from saturating when you're working around powerful signals (like overhead transmission lines) or in downtown settings with lots of background electromagnetic noise. Multi-frequency capability also helps in cities; you can switch frequencies to avoid coupling onto unintended nearby lines.

By contrast, rural environments often involve longer distance locates with fewer sources of interference. Here, the priority is a strong transmitter and low-frequency output to reach the end of that long gas main or telecom line stretching down a country highway. For rural work, ensure your locator has a long-range mode (and consider accessories like signal clamps or ground rods that improve coupling).

In summary, urban jobs benefit from sophisticated filtering and frequency agility to combat congestion, while rural jobs demand raw power and range.

Budget vs. Accuracy Tradeoffs

Professional utility locators span a wide price range, so it's important to align your budget with your performance needs. There are basic wands for under $500, but these entry-level tools have limited depth range and minimal features.

Most high-quality, professional-grade locators fall in the $2,000 to $10,000 range, reflecting their advanced capabilities and rugged build. Spending more typically gets you greater depth accuracy, more frequencies, and features like GPS integration or data logging.

If you only need to locate occasionally and at shallow depths, a lower-cost device might suffice. But be cautious about under-buying – a bargain locator that can't handle difficult locates (deep, in congested areas, or non-standard utilities) can lead to missed lines and costly mistakes.

Accuracy and reliability are critical for safety and damage prevention, so invest in the level of technology that your work demands.

Utility Locator Comparison (Brand Guide)

When evaluating specific locator models, it's helpful to see how the major brands stack up. The table below compares some of the best utility locating equipment in terms of their ideal use cases, key strengths, and limitations. This overview will give you a sense of which manufacturer or model might align with your needs, whether you prioritize depth, ease of use, or advanced features.

Utility Locator Comparison Matrix
Commercial Utility Locator Comparison
Brand/Model Best Use Case Strengths Limitations
Radiodetection (e.g. RD8200) High-precision locating on complex utilities; mapping and documentation needs. Multi-frequency (active and passive) with deep reach (detects 18+ ft); optional built-in GPS/RTK for survey-grade maps; rugged for harsh environments. Higher cost due to higher quality.
Vivax-Metrotech (vLoc3-Pro series) Versatile multi-utility locating on diverse job sites (utility locating with some mapping capability). Durable and field-proven. Wide frequency range (16 Hz up to 200 kHz) covers many locating scenarios; supports external RTK GPS for high-accuracy mapping when needed. No native GPS integration (requires external receiver for mapping). Interface and features slightly less advanced compared to Radiodetection's flagship models, but comes at lower cost (approx. $3k–$6k range).
Schonstedt (u-LOCATE / REX) Quick, everyday utility locates – ideal for private locating and 811 ticket verification. Ultra-lightweight, single-hand operation – easy for anyone to use. New models offer multi-frequency capability (e.g. u-LOCATE+ has 33 kHz/82 kHz and sonde mode) for general-purpose locating. More affordable than top-tier locators (base kits in the $1–$3k range). Maximum locate depth of ~18 ft and no integrated GPS or data logging. Lacks some high-end features (like on-board interference filtering) found in pricier units, making it less suited to very congested or challenging environments.
Leica (DD120 series) Simple, fast locating for contractors on small-scale projects (e.g. building sites, home construction). Very user-friendly ("turn-on-and-go" design). Provides reliable basic detection of utilities with minimal setup. Also budget-friendly – starting around $1,400 for a new unit. Single-frequency operation with limited depth (~3 m or 10 ft max), so it cannot reach or detect deeper lines well. No advanced features (GPS, Bluetooth, etc.) – it's purely a basic locator, which may struggle in complex utility corridors or with non-conductive lines.
Pipehorn (Model 800HL) Locating deep or long-run metallic utilities in challenging soil conditions (popular for pipe tracing in rural or industrial settings). Dual-frequency design including a very low frequency (audio range) that penetrates far into ground – excellent for long distance tracing. Known for its robust, waterproof construction; proven in harsh field environments and difficult terrain. Old-school analog technology (needle gauge and sound; no graphical display). No GPS or memory – purely a manual locator. Only works on conductive lines – it cannot help with plastic pipes unless a tracer wire or metallic conduit is present.
Amprobe (AT-3500) Electrical utility work – tracing energized cables and finding breaks or ground faults in power lines. Also usable on de-energized lines. Specifically designed for electric line locating: comes with clamp accessories to induce signals on live wires, and it provides clear visual/audible indicators to pinpoint cables. Good for troubleshooting circuits (finding opens or shorts). Niche focus on electrical applications; not as versatile for plumbing or telecom use. On the higher end of price (~$4.5k–$7k) given its specialized scope. Lacks multi-frequency breadth of other brands – primarily tailored to power frequencies and tones.

Sources: Manufacturer data and Locator Guys product information (Approx. prices are for reference; actual pricing may vary).
